Sole Source: If sale is less than $77,250, sole source is not used here—skip and use a coop; if ≥ $77,250, run a competitive bid.
Coops: Lead with the Ohio DAS Cooperative Purchasing Program or the ODOT Cooperative Purchasing Program; for the Board of Developmental Disabilities, use their Sourcewell membership.
Henry County, OH shows no evidence of sole source contracting. Skip this path and pursue cooperative purchasing or direct competitive bidding for opportunities over the state threshold.
Board meetings and strategic plans from Henry County
The meetings include discussions on budget adjustments and financial obligations, updates from local representatives, and the conduct of public hearings for the 2026 Chip and CDBG programs. The board will consider resolutions regarding housing impact and application submissions to the Ohio Department of Development, as well as operational discussions regarding a radio tower and the Palmer Energy proposal. Additionally, there will be a review of a resolution to proceed with a levy.
The board conducted a public hearing for a tire rate increase and received a transportation update. An executive session was held regarding pending litigation with no action taken. The commissioners approved budget adjustments, payments, an IT services agreement with the Henry County Health Department, administration for the CDBG program, a change order for the Courthouse Renovation Project, and the creation of a fund for the Family Connects Ohio Grant.
The meeting included a bid opening for 2026 aggregate, a public hearing for CDBG projects, and updates regarding transportation and the landfill. The Board passed several resolutions, including budget adjustments, organizational appointments, and the approval of the clerk to the Board. Additionally, the commissioners approved an audit contract with Julian & Grube, participation in the ODOT cooperative purchasing program, a 2026 truck fund for EMA, and the allocation of delinquent tax collections to the Henry County Land Reutilization Corporation.
The board conducted a second public hearing regarding a tire rate increase. Additionally, the board processed and signed various resolutions during the session.
The Board entered into an executive session to discuss security matters. Key business items included a request for operational expense funding from the Humane Society, a discussion regarding 2026 ditch maintenance rates, and an aggregate recertification presentation. The Board passed resolutions to approve budget adjustments, 'then and now' purchase orders, 2026 ditch maintenance rates, and the PUCO recertification for aggregate.
